The panels, or fairings, are being brought to market by Freight Wing Inc., which developed the product with the help of a grant from the Department of Energy. The company claims that results on a test track showed a seven percent reduction in the full consumption for a fully loaded tractor-trailers, equivalent to about 1,100 gallons of diesel fuel every 100,000 miles. Depending on the price of fuel, the fairings could save $1,500 to $2,000 per truck during that period.
Transport America, which operates more than 5,000 trailers, spends $48 million per year on fuel, according to a Freight Wing news release.
Trucking companies can also use the fairings to qualify for the Environmental Protection Agency’s SmartWay Transport initiative, a voluntary program that encourages carriers to adopt more efficient technologies and management practices to reduce diesel fuel emissions.
